4. Why do some sites explain emoji meanings?

Because emojis can have different meanings in different cultures or contexts. Knowing the meaning helps avoid confusion or sending the wrong message.

5. Are new emojis added every year?

Yes, new emojis are approved regularly by the Unicode Consortium. Good emoji sites update their collections to include these new icons as soon as they become available.
